House Wrecking in Beaumont, TX
House wrecking services involve the careful demolition and removal of entire residential structures, typically when preparing a property for new construction, renovations, or clearing space for other projects. These services cover a range of projects, including complete house demolitions, interior strip-outs, and the removal of old or unsafe structures. Property owners usually want to understand the scope of the demolition, the process involved, and any necessary preparations before requesting house wrecking services to ensure the project aligns with their goals and timelines.
Before requesting house wrecking, property owners should consider factors such as the size and structure of the home, the presence of hazardous materials like asbestos or lead paint, and local regulations regarding demolition permits and disposal. It’s also helpful to clarify whether the project includes salvage or recycling of materials and to understand the logistics involved in clearing debris from the site. Having a clear plan for the demolition process can help ensure the project proceeds smoothly and safely.

Common House Wrecking Jobs
House demolition - complete removal of entire structures to prepare for new construction or renovation.
Interior demolition - tearing down interior walls, flooring, and fixtures to update or remodel living spaces.
Selective demolition - carefully dismantling specific parts of a house to preserve certain areas while removing others.
Foundation removal - safely breaking down and removing old or damaged foundations to make way for repairs or rebuilds.
Garage and shed demolition - dismantling detached structures to clear space or replace outdated buildings.
Asbestos and hazardous material removal - safe removal of dangerous materials during demolition projects to protect property and occupants.
House Wrecking Questions
What types of structures can be demolished? House wrecking services typically handle residential homes, including single-family houses, townhouses, and small commercial buildings.
Is the process safe for surrounding properties? Proper planning and techniques ensure nearby properties and structures are protected during demolition work.
What should be prepared before wrecking begins? Clear access to the site and remove valuable or fragile items to facilitate a smooth demolition process.
Are permits required for house wrecking? Local regulations often require permits, and guidance can be provided to ensure compliance with all necessary approvals.
